Denbey is a rare given name derived from the English surname Denby, itself taken from several places in Yorkshire and Derbyshire. The place-name comes from Old Norse bȳ “farmstead, village” combined either with Deni, a Scandinavian personal name, or with Old English Dena “Danes,” yielding meanings such as “Deni’s farm” or “Danish settlement.” As a forename, Denbey arises from the modern surname-to-first-name trend and sees occasional use in English-speaking countries from the late 20th century onward.
Variant spellings include Denby (the customary form), Denbee, and Denbie; related names are Danby and Denbigh (from Welsh Dinbych, “little fort”). Nicknames might be Den or Denny.
